logo

Output 981063205672f8c2874795b9b898b217160e0e2092732364d3e38e3b54418ac5:1

value
184338892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ac4f5f8fdeb62b61e623b8f4ae8c1e715492fb6 OP_EQUAL
address
35bAFgLbMh5jkH8Ngh6B9SKuqQ7Ts8bwEw
transaction
981063205672f8c2874795b9b898b217160e0e2092732364d3e38e3b54418ac5